In the first quarter of 2026, FORVIA HELLA kicked off the new fiscal year with solid sales performance, demonstrating strong growth momentum in the automotive LED lighting sector. According to the latest industry data released by LEDinside, the company's sales increased by 12% year-over-year in this quarter, with its vehicle lighting product line showing particularly outstanding performance, becoming a key driver of overall business results.
Amid the rapid development of new energy vehicles, FORVIA HELLA continues to increase investment in R&D for high-brightness, low-energy LED light sources and intelligent lighting systems. Its multiple high-power LED modules and integrated lighting solutions have been widely applied to mainstream vehicle models, especially in headlight and taillight applications, receiving high recognition from customers. In addition, breakthroughs in modular design and lightweight technology have further enhanced the product's market competitiveness.
Notably, under the backdrop of global supply chain fluctuations and rising raw material prices, FORVIA HELLA has effectively controlled costs through optimized production processes and strengthened localized procurement strategies, ensuring stable delivery capabilities and a positive customer experience.
